Self-Programming

In the years leading up to the 21st century the technology for car keys began to evolve away from mechanical keys and became an amalgamation of physical and electronic protocols to guard against theft. Many of these new keys have a microchip integrated within them that must be programmed to connect them to your vehicle's electronic system. Professional locksmiths with the necessary equipment can reprogram your keys. Many cars, particularly high-end ones, require that only the dealer be able to create new keys.

If you want to attempt this yourself, the method varies by manufacturer. In general, you will have to insert the spare key into the ignition and then manipulate it (according to the instructions in the owner's manual) until the car enters programming mode. It is necessary to move quickly to complete the procedure, since it only lasts just a few seconds until your car leaves the mode.

Once your car is in programming mode, you will need to repeat the process for each key that you want to program. The owner's manual should contain specific instructions for the particular model and key type that you want to program. Certain models come with extra security features that need to be enabled.

Certain models of cars require an additional code that must be obtained from a dealer at a cost to you. This code can help protect you from "skimming" which happens the process where thieves attempt to read the data of your key through the OBD2 port to start the mobile car key programming and steal it.

Key Programmers

If you've lost your car keys, or when you're replacing them, you might wonder whether it's possible to reprogram car keys the key. It's contingent on the manufacturer, however the majority of vehicles require you to collaborate with a dealer or auto locksmith to have the new key inserted into the vehicle's system. This requires reprogramming the new key's transponder so that it matches the settings of the car that was originally programmed car keys.

While some vehicles allow you to do this on your own but most require a dealer or professional to use a special tool that is able to connect to the vehicle and read programming information from the ECU. The key is then reprogrammed so that it matches the car's settings and you can use it as a regular key.

There are numerous kinds of car programing key programmers, some of which work with specific makes and models of vehicles, while others are more universal and can be used on a range of vehicles. Most of these tools feature small displays and a variety of buttons to enter the programming modes. Then, you can plug the device into the OBD-II port to begin reading and programming the new key.

Professionals can program a new car key in just a few minutes, however certain cars require more time and complicated procedures to reprogram keys properly. For instance, certain modern vehicles require a special code that only the car dealer has access to and uses to access the immobilizer's system. In these situations it is best to leave the job to professionals to ensure that you don't harm the system and have no means to start your car.

Key Fobs

Modern day key fobs provide a host of security and convenience benefits. They can replace or enhance traditional car keys and can manage more than only locking doors. They can start the engine, activate the alarm and perform other functions.

The key fob communicates to the receiver inside the vehicle by using radio signals. When you press the button on the keyfob it sends the code to the receiver, which does the job you want it to. Key fobs are also very popular with commercial building owners who can incorporate them into an access control system. This lets them track who enters and exits, and block fobs which have been stolen or lost.

Key fobs, as with any electronic device, can malfunction. They can be damaged or lose their signal if they are placed in purses and pockets. And although they are built to withstand many things, they're not impervious to damage; after all, they're little more than metal and plastic.

If your key fobs aren't working, you may need to replace the battery. Make sure to use the correct battery, and refer to your owner's manual to learn how to replace it correctly. Be sure to follow all additional steps needed for reprogramming and calibration.

Another common cause of failed fobs is wear and tear. They can crack or break when dropped, bumped against things, and jostled around in purses and pockets. Sometimes, a quick and inexpensive fix is all that is required to get your key fobs up and running.

Keyless Entry

Keyless entry lets you unlock your car and begin it without the need to insert a physical key. It uses a wireless signal to communicate with the car's internal system and it also lets you to control different functions in the vehicle like climate control or music systems.

Modern keyless entry systems employ rolling code technology to guard against security breaches. It is important to keep in mind that even this technology is not 100% secure. Using a technique called "replay attack" thieves can use the transmitter of the key fob to transmit a message which is recorded by the car's receiver. Once the message is recorded an intruder device could retransmit the same transmission to the car's receiver and gain access to the secured property.

Based on the make and model of your vehicle, you might be capable of programming new keys yourself, or employ an automotive locksmith to do it. Certain car manufacturers offer an onboard program that is specifically designed, while others require that you have an advanced programmer attached to the OBD2 connector.

The most common method to program new keys for cars is to insert the key fob into the ignition and turn it on in a particular order. Once the car is in "programming mode," one or more buttons on the fob are pressed to transmit the digital identification code to the computer. The computer saves the code and then removes the car from the programming mode.

Certain manufacturers require you to have a special advanced programmer to program key fobs and some of them are expensive and difficult to use for a common person. This is why it is generally better to let an automotive locksmith or dealer do the job for you.

To begin the process of programming a key the new keyless entry car key, get into your car on the driver's side and shut all the doors, with the exception of the driver's door. This will stop the system from locking your doors as you attempt to program the key. Then, with the ignition key in place and the other keys you wish to program close by, press and hold the button on the fob you wish to activate until the warning lights flash twice.
